Koblenz (Germany) - October 15, 2008: CompuGROUP Holding AG, a leading  European 
eHealth company, reports the expansion of  the  group's  management  board:  The 
supervisory board has appointed Professor Dr. med.  Stefan  F.  Winter  a  board 
member of CompuGROUP, effective from October 16, 2008. The forty-eight year  old 
Stefan F. Winter  will  be  specifically  responsible  for  product  management, 
product development and research  with  a  focus  on  medical  decision  support 
systems. 
 
Until the middle of August 2008, Professor Dr. med. Stefan Winter has worked  as 
State Secretary of the Ministry for Labor, Health  and  Social  Affairs  of  the 
federal state North Rhine-Westphalia. Between 1992 and 2005, the  physician  and 
molecular biologist  has  held  various  managerial  positions  at  the  Federal 
Ministry of Health. Among others,  he  also  managed  the  "Prevention,  Disease 
Control and Biomedicine" department. 
 
Similarly, Professor Winter possesses comprehensive experience in  international 
healthcare politics and has  numerous  scientific  contacts  abroad.  From  1992 
until 2004, he was a member of the European Steering  Committee  for  Biomedical 
Ethics at the Council of Europe. In addition he has worked as an advisor of  the 
World Health Organization (WHO) since 2000.

About CompuGROUP Holding AG 
CompuGROUP is one of the leading  eHealth  companies  worldwide.  Its  software 
products, designed to support all  medical  and  organizational  activities  in 
doctors' offices and  hospitals,  its  information  services  for  all  parties 
involved in the healthcare system and its  web-based  personal  health  records 
contribute towards  safer  and  more  efficient  healthcare.  The  services  of 
CompuGROUP are based on its unique customer  base  of  about  330,000  doctors, 
dentists, hospitals,  associations  and  networks  as  well  as  other  service 
providers. CompuGROUP is the eHealth company with the  biggest  coverage  among 
eHealth service providers  worldwide.  The  company  operates  in  14  European 
countries, Malaysia, Saudi Arabia and in South  Africa  and  currently  employs 
around 2,600 people.
